Orthotists and Prosthetists salary by percentile in Arizona
BLS-reported salary distribution — from entry-level (10th percentile) to top earners (90th percentile).
Orthotists and Prosthetists in Arizona earn a median salary of $67,350 per year ($5,612/month).
This is 15.7% below the national average of $79,921.
Arizona ranks #36 out of 44 states for Orthotists and Prosthetists pay.
Approximately 70 people work in this occupation across Arizona.
Salaries increased by 4.0% compared to 2024.

Salary Range: Orthotists and Prosthetists in Arizona
Salaries for Orthotists and Prosthetists in Arizona range from $50,020 at the 10th percentile (entry level) to $107,370 at the 90th percentile (experienced). The middle 50% earn between $62,520 and $100,160.

Salary data is sourced from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) survey, 2025 estimates. The OEWS survey covers approximately 1.1 million establishments nationwide.
Annual salaries are calculated based on a standard 2,080-hour work year. Actual compensation may vary based on experience, education, employer, and local market conditions. Figures do not include benefits, bonuses, or overtime pay.
